Here's a brief overview of the roles and their respective market percentages: 1. **Network Engineer (IoT)** - 35%: These professionals ensure seamless connectivity, integrating IoT devices and protocols. Network engineers specializing in IoT networking are in high demand across numerous industries. 2. **Data Scientist (IoT)** - 25%: As IoT devices generate massive amounts of data, data scientists are essential for interpreting and creating actionable insights from this information. 3. **Security Specialist (IoT)** - 20%: Ensuring the security of IoT networks is a critical concern for businesses. IoT security experts design, implement, and monitor security protocols to protect sensitive data and systems. 4. **Automation Expert (IoT)** - 15%: Automation specialists help businesses streamline operations and reduce costs by implementing IoT-based automation solutions. 5. **Connectivity Manager (IoT)** - 5%: Connectivity managers oversee IoT-based communication networks, ensuring optimal performance and coordinating maintenance and upgrades.
